Can I run FCP7 and FCP X on the same system?

  I can't open my FCP 7 projects in FCP X so I will need both programs to run simultaneously so I can access previous work while building new cuts.  This seems utterly ridiculous but it appears to be true.  Please correct me if I'm wrong since I have more than 400 FCP 7 projects, the majority of which are still ongoing... what do I do to handle this, start from scratch on 400 projects that date back several years... brutal.

Personally, I'd never switch a project in which I've invested time and effort to a new application, other than a test project to begin the investigation into how the new app could work in the future. I don't think "pros" even update an existing app like FCP while in a project unless the update is specifically for an issue they are having with their project. FCP7 is great and will continue to be great, ongoing projects should stay there.
It will be interesting to see as FCP X matures if Apple or a third party develops a way to import FCP7 projects, or at least aspects of it, but as FCP X is such a different approach I wouldn't count on it.
Apparently that means that someday we'll need to "freeze" an FCP7 installed system in time (not today, but in the next year os so) to be able to just work on and have access to FCP7 projects. New and discontinued apps are a fact of life in computer world, as inconvenient as it may be. Operating Systems, and hardware that will run them, go away too. In 20+ years I've had to abandon OS platforms, apps, and documents, or make a switch where I had to start over, but never anything as complex or meaningful as my FCP7 projects.

  • How can I run two independant LabView applications from the same computer, without taking a performance hit?

    I have two identical, but independant test stations, both feeding data back to a Data Acquisition Computer running LabView 6.1. Everything is duplicated at the computer as well, with two E-series multifunction I/O cards (one for each test station) and two instances of the same LabView program for acquiring and analysing the data. The DAQ computer has a Celeron processor w/ 850Mhz clock and 512MB memory, and is running on Windows NT.
    I have noticed that when I run both the applications simultaneously, I take a substantial performance hit in terms of processing speed (as opposed to running just one program). Why does this happen and how can I prevent it? (In t
    his particular case, it may be possible to combine both the tests into one program since they are identical, but independant, simultaneous control of two different LabView programs is a concept I need to prove out).
    Thanks in advance for any tips, hints and spoon feedings (!)....

    Depending on your application, you may or may not be able to improve things.
    Firstly, each task requires CPU time, so a certain performance difference is guaranteed. Making sure you have a "wait until ms" in every while loop helps in all but the most CPU intensive programs.
    Secondly, if you are
    1) streaming data to disk
    2) Acquiring lots of data over the PCI bus
    3) Sending lots of data o ver the network
    you can have bottlenecks elsewhere than in your program (limited Disk, PCI or Network bandwidth).
    Avoid also displaying data which doesn`t need to be displayed. An array indicator which only shows one element still needs a lot of processing time if the array itself is large.... Best is to set the indicator invisible if this is the case.
    I think
    it would be best if you could give some more information about the amount of data being acquired, processed and sent. Then maybe it will be more obvious where you can optimise things. If you are running W2000, try activating the task manager while the program(s) are sunning to see where the bottleneck is.

    Hi,Carol
    First, (and to reiterate what Rick said) if you are not publishing to RoboHelp Server right now. Do NOT use WebHelp Pro. The Pro flavor is strictly for hosting on a RoboHelp Server installation.
    The good news is that when and if you do decide to use RoboHelp Server, you simply take the Rh project (whether from Rh 10 or 11) and publish it with the WebHelp Pro SSL. It sounds like there is a some confusion between RoboHelp Server and Source Control. It is a common option to use RoboHelp Server and Source Control. But they are mutually exclusive. (While both may be used, they have nothing to do with one another.)
    If you think about it, RoboHelp Server is output (by definition not "source")
    So, you can continue using Rh 10 and 11 clients on the same computer, but as you note, you cannot open an Rh 10 project in Rh 11 because it is a one-way forward conversion (as Peter said).
    As for publishing, be aware that when you move to RoboHelp Server, the publishing workflow is different. The web admin can't simply copy/paste WebHelp Pro output (from source control as you describe) to the Rh Server (or, as you said, "pick up files"). The project must be published from the RoboHelp 10/11 client directly to the Rh Server. This is because Rh Server is a database application and in order for the database to be "aware" of the new content, it must come from the RoboHelp client app (10 or 11). Also, in terms of Application Help and context sensitivity, there is a CSH API and a syntax that is used to call the Rh Server help topics from the application. This is covered in the online help. See the sub head "Access context-sensitive Help" in the Adobe RoboHelp Server 9 * RoboHelp Server Web Administrator tasks as well as Adobe RoboHelp 11 * Program Help for web pages

  • Running Production Premium CS5 & CS6 on the same system / any issues ?

    Still not sure which way to go with the CS6 upgrade, non-Creative cloud version.. 
    Run both on the same system or uninstall CS5 first.. 
    Prefer not to slow down the system but CS5 is running perfectly now..  
    Anyone tried both at the same time ?
    How is opening existing CS5 projects with CS6, this is a concern for me & why I might like to have both installed on the same system ?

    Having installed CS5, CS5.5, CS6 and CC is no problem. They are separate installs.
    Moving projects from CS5 --> CS5.5 --> CS6 --> CC is no problem.
    Moving projects from CC --> CS6 is not possible.
    Moving projects from CS6 --> CS5.5 can be problematic.
